Pawan Kalyan's 'Bheemla Nayak' Officially Postponed To Clear Roads For 'RRR' And 'Radhe Shyam'
Hyderabad, December 21 - As reported earlier, power star Pawan Kalyan's "Bheemla Nayak" has officially been postponed and is out from Sankranthi 2022 race. The new release date is yet to be announced but it will most certainly be released on February 25, 2022. ## Earlier, the makers of "Bheemla Nayak" were promoting the film as Sankranthi 2022 release, but the producer's guild intervened in the issue and made the film opt for another date as it would have dented the box office potential of Pan India biggies "RRR" and "Radhe Shyam", which are slated for Jan. 7 and Jan. 14 release, respectively. ## It is said that Pawan Kalyan has agreed to the producer's guild's suggestion in the larger interest of the Telugu film industry. Directed by Saagar Chandra and written by Trivikram, the film is the official remake of the Malayalam hit, Ayyapanum Koshiyum. It also stars Rana Daggubati and Nithya Menen in key roles. ## Meanwhile, Venkatesh and Varun Tej's "F3" will now release on April 29th, 2022. It was supposed to release in Feb/March 2022. On the other hand, Mahesh Babu's "Sarkaru Vaari Paata" will be released on April 1st as scheduled (as of now). Earlier, it was originally announced for January 13, 2022, but postponed to make things easy for others films. ## Megastar Chiranjeevi and Ram Charan's "Acharya" will also be released as scheduled on February 4, 2022. There were speculations that it will move further, but, there is no such official development yet. Nagarjuna's "Bangarraju", meanwhile, is planning to release on January 15 or 21 in theaters.## Stay tuned...
